Strengthening Animal Welfare Legislation
How: we have been continously been involved in the review of animal related legislation in Malawi, which most recently included a proposal for the inclusion of a new bill, the Animal Welfare and Animal Health Bill, to replace the Protection of Animals Act of 1970.

Influencing Policy and Legislation
What: we play a key role in shaping national and local government policies and contributing to legislative reforms, ensuring that animal welfare is a priority at the government level.
How : our efforts have played a major role in shaping key national policies, including;
- Establishment of the National Animal Welfare Guidelines of Malawi (2018-2029).
- The national Rabies Strategy of Malawi which strives to achieve Zero Rabies by 2030.
- The draft Animal Welfare and Animal Health Bill, developed in collaboration with the Department of Animal Health and Livestock Development (DAHLD) and other stakeholders.
